Understanding HDB Purchase Eligibility and Application Process To qualify for an HDB purchase, applicants must meet specific criteria. These include citizenship status, age, family nucleus, and financial capacity. Singaporean citizens or Permanent Residents entering through the family nucleus scheme must demonstrate eligibility based on their familial ties. Procedure for application involves several crucial steps: - Check eligibility: Verify whether you meet criteria pertaining to citizenship, age, and family type. - Submit an application: Use the online portal to apply for an HDB unit, selecting the appropriate scheme. - Obtain Approval in Principle: After submitting your application, await the In-Principle Approval (IPA) letter indicating your eligibility. - Choose a flat: Once approved, select a flat according to availability and preference. - Sign the agreement: Upon selecting a unit, you will need to sign the necessary agreements and finalize financial arrangements. Red flags to consider: - Incomplete documentation: Ensure all required documents are submitted for a smoother process. - Changes in eligibility status: Be aware of any life changes that might affect your application. - Financial constraints: Assess your financial standing thoroughly before applying. - Overlooking resale restrictions: Familiarize yourself with any resale limitations attached to your chosen flat.
